What has been your experience with the .35 Whelen on deer? Made a hunt with a group last year. All deer shot with the .35 ran off. Ones shot with a 45.70 fell in tracks. I have killed a dozen or so with my 45.70. All in tracks or within 5 yards. I like the idea of longer range capability with the .35. I limit my shots to less than 200 yards with the 45.70 now.
Posted on 8/11/17 at 5:20 pm to dwr353
I love mine, its all I hunt with year-round beings all my shots are sub-200. 2 kills so far and the first one stopped in its tracks, second wasnt far from where it was shot.
We've had people have them run off after being shot on our lease as well. I think it comes down to bullet and shot placement

Not sure what to tell you, the farthest I've had one go is 20 yards, and between everyone I know maybe 3 out of 20 deer haven't bang flopped with the 35. Like downshift said you should avoid bonded bullets designed for elk cause they may pass through without much expansion, but I shoot bondeds and haven't had an issue.
